Programmatically add rows to a Table element

<Window xmlns="http://schemas.microsoft.com/winfx/2006/xaml/presentation"     xmlns:x="http://schemas.microsoft.com/winfx/2006/xaml"         x:Class="WpfApplication1.Window1"     Title="Add Content to a Table">   <FlowDocumentScrollViewer HorizontalAlignment="Left" VerticalAlignment="Top">     <FlowDocument>       <Paragraph>         <Button Canvas.Left="5" Click="AddRow">Add a New TableRow to the Table</Button>       </Paragraph>       <Table CellSpacing="5" Name="table1">         <Table.Columns>           <TableColumn/>         </Table.Columns>         <TableRowGroup Name="trg1">           <TableRow>             <TableCell>               <Paragraph FontSize="14pt">TableRow</Paragraph>             </TableCell>           </TableRow>         </TableRowGroup>       </Table>     </FlowDocument>   </FlowDocumentScrollViewer> </Window> //File:Window.xaml.cs using System; using System.Windows; using System.Windows.Controls; using System.Windows.Documents; namespace WpfApplication1 {   public partial class Window1 : Window   {         public void AddRow(object sender, RoutedEventArgs e)         {             TableRow row = new TableRow();             trg1.Rows.Add(row);             Paragraph para = new Paragraph();             para.Inlines.Add("A new Row and Cell have been Added to the Table");             TableCell cell = new TableCell(para);             row.Cells.Add(cell);         }     } }
